FE2 and FE3 encompass several things:
1. FE2 cars use a hollow 24mm front swaybar; FE3 cars have a solid 24mm front swaybar.
2. FE3 dampers (struts) have slightly firmer valving for a sportier ride.
3. FE3 cars have slightly firmer bushings in various suspension components.
